Synth EP Review: “Klash Elektro’’ by Jetfire Prime

Jetfire Prime’s Klash Elektro explodes with summery energy and fascinating synth textures. It combines unique melodies and ear-grabbing sonic signatures to weave a thrilling tapestry.


“Heart Strings” comes into being as a blinding, explosive synth dances out with energizing motion. Clapping percussion with hollow resonance jumps into a groovy pulse as the angular melody slices with invigorating liveliness above thick bass.

Raised, crystalline tones sparkle in a frolicking melody while the lead instrument twists in funky motion. High notes glide through with ferocious brightness as drums rebound. The main melody gets into my body, making me want to move and shimmy while glimmering notes skip joyfully through the sound.

The low end drives an irresistible, playful rhythm as the melody pops and locks with unstoppable positivity. Enveloping notes wash over everything and the track ends in radiant light.


Explosive drums beat out an insistent pulse while a hugely flaring synth cuts through with sharp brilliance as “Love Note Antidote” kicks off. Exuberant vitality radiates from the synth as hollow, bouncing notes twist into an angular melody that wriggles with irresistible motion.

The low end is clean and resonant as a wide, vibrating synth calls out with a blend of faint melancholy and driving energy. Razor-edged tones interlock and the bass erupts as tightly bubbling synth pops shimmer across the soundscape, carrying me with a groovy momentum. Medium-high notes quiver with barely contained force and then the music drops into silence.


“Elektro Klash” starts with clapping percussion and hollow, flat synth pulsing as active drums cascade across the stereo channels. Laser-like sounds add technical sharpness while wildly intermingling rhythms and drum textures are cut by exuberant notes which reverberate and sing.

Angular momentum fills the track as interlocking elements blaze with computerized brightness. I enjoy the tightly wound sensation of the music, like a spring about to be released. The intensely varied percussion batters and bounces as crystalline notes wriggle with a swinging groove.

The madly flying drum components each contribute a unique sound to the layered, sharp-edged notes which pop through the music with shimmying liveliness. Cascading percussion adds richness as it moves in waves before the track closes with unending dynamism.


The drum beat punches with live-wire energy as digital-sounding notes sparkle like diamond shards to start “Night Kruisin”. The ferociously bright notes radiate sunlight as entangling, string-like tones slice with thrilling drama.

As the rippling digital-sounding synth twirls, images of rushing down a brightly lit highway fill the music. A sense of anticipatory tension hangs over the tightly glowing melody, conjuring up feelings of a night drive toward unknown adventure.

I enjoy the flashing intensity of the main melody, making my heart beat faster with thrill and adrenaline, while the rippling background contributes luscious light. A widely percussive pulse adds exotic sounds and exuberant energy above the funky bass that cuts through.

Medium-high twisting notes weave a pattern of unstoppable uplift while the synth brings the funk above ear-catching percussion. The main melody draws pictures of neon skylines and a powerful car charging down the road. Excitement and joyful hope fill the track before the music ends.
